+#ifndef __MCAMESSAGESWRITEINTERFACE_H__
+#define __MCAMESSAGESWRITEINTERFACE_H__
+
+// FORWARD CLASS DECLERATIONS
+class MCAMessage;
+
+// CLASS DECLARATION
+
+/**
+ * Interface for write access to messages.
+ *
+ * @lib CAEngine.dll
+ * @since 3.0
+ */
+class MCAMessagesWriteInterface
+ {
+ public: // Interface
+
+ /**
+ * Append one message to container.
+ * @param aMessage. New message to container.
+ * @param aSharedOwnerShip EFalse if ownership is tranferred, ETrue if shared.
+ */
+ virtual void AppendL( MCAMessage* aMessage, TBool aSharedOwnership = EFalse ) = 0;
+
+ /**
+ * Set screenname corresponding the container if needed.
+ * @param aScreenName Screen name of user.
+ */
+ virtual void SetScreenNameL( const TDesC& aScreenName ) = 0;
+
+ /**
+ * Get screenname corresponding the container.
+ * @return Own screenname in group.
+ */
+ virtual const TDesC& OwnScreenName() const = 0;
+
+ /**
+ * With this we can lock buffer memory handling for not
+ * to free memory if memory runs out. Used for example
+ * when opening recorded chats when we do not want
+ * to clear active messages because there is not
+ * enough memory to open recorded chats.
+ */
+ virtual void LockBufferMemoryHandling( TBool aLocked ) = 0;
+
+ /**
+ * Get the time and date of the last message written to this interface,
+ * Time is used to determine the need of datestamp.
+ * @return Date and time of the last message. if there are no
+ * previous messages, then returns Time::NullTTime()
+ */
+ virtual TTime Time() = 0;
+
+ /**
+ * Virtual destructor
+ */
+ virtual ~MCAMessagesWriteInterface() {}
+ };
+
+#endif // __MCAMESSAGESWRITEINTERFACE_H__
